Donald Gibb, star of Revenge of the Nerds and Bloodsport, has died at 71, his family confirmed to Rolling Stone. His son, Travis Gibb, told TMZ it was from "health complications."
A 6-foot-4 physical specimen for much of his decades' long acting career, Gibb had a unique screen presence. His imposing size could make him menacing on screen, yet he could also use it for physical comedy at a moment's notice.
Gibb's first credited screen role came in 1983, and he appeared in a film that released this year, an action-drama called Hands. He made countless film and television appearances in between.

“It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Donald Gibb — a beloved father, grandfather, great-grandfather, brother, uncle, friend, and actor. Donald loved the Lord, his family, his friends, and his fans with all his heart,” the Gibb family statement read. “Known for his larger-than-life presence on screen and his kindness off screen, he brought joy, laughter, and unforgettable memories to countless people throughout his life and career.”
Gibb's death comes three months after the passing of Robert Carradine, his Revenge of the Nerds co-star. Carradine, who died by suicide, was also 71.
